About Us

AussieTheatre.com is an interactive theatre and arts platform servicing the Australian performing arts community and theatre-going public. Our aim is to create an engaging and informative platform that supports an appreciation of artists and the Australian arts industry.

We acknowledge the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Peoples as the traditional custodians of the land. We pay our respects to their Elders, past and present. We thank them for their storytelling, music and dance, and appreciate their impact on the performing arts industry.
